Basketball players named to All-American team
Pima basketball players Tia Morrison and Abyee Maracigan have been honored by being named to the 2009 National Junior College Athletic Association Division II All-American team.
Tia Morrison (FR, Phoenix, AZ, Copper Canyon HS) was selected for the First Team. She scored over 16 points and had over 11 rebounds each game, leading the Aztecs in both categories. Morrison also averaged a double-double each night, and helped out defensively by blocked 45 shots and making 36 steals.
Abyee Maracigan (FR, Tucson, AZ, Flowing Wells HS) was selected for the Third Team. The freshman guard averaged over 13 points per game, made 163 assists and 78 steals. Maracigan also led the team in minutes, playing over 33 minutes each night and often playing the full 40 minutes.
